Profile Summary
Eko International Corp is a holding company. The Company focuses on examining a range of proposed target businesses and if interested, intends to negotiate terms and conditions of purchase favorable to it. The Company holds interests in NeuroVasc Clinical Inc. The business of NeuroVasc Clinical Inc. is to promote and distribute Frequency Rhythmic Electrical Modulation System (FREMS) equipment supplied by Lorenz Neurovasc Inc.; set up and/or manage clinics to treat patients using FREMS equipment, and set up training and certification centers for technicians in the use of FREMS equipment. FREMS equipment is used in the treatment of peripheral neuropathy, which is damage to nerves in extremities, such as lower legs and feet, causing an interruption in communication between the brain and parts of the body with damaged nerves.

The PE ratio (or price-to-earnings ratio) is the one of the most popular valuation measures used by stock market investors. It is calculated by dividing a company's price per share by its earnings per share.
The PE ratio can be seen as being expressed in years, in the sense that it shows the number of years of earnings which would be required to pay back the purchase price, ignoring inflation. So in general terms, the higher the PE, the more expensive the stock is.
